OaklandCityCouncil | 2003-11-18 | Subject: Fox Theater Restoration From: Community and Economic Development Agency 22 Recommendation: A Continued discussion to Adopt the following legislation: 1) Adopt a Resolution authorizing amendment to the repayment agreement with the Redevelopment Agency and increasing City appropriations by $800,000, and authorizing the City Manager to enter into a contract in an amount not to exceed $800,000 with California Capital Group for predevelopment work on the Fox Theater and wrap around buildings ( PURSUANT TO SECTION 902-E OF THE CITY CHARTER, THIS ITEM REQUIRES A 2/3 VOTE); and Attachments: Item 22 11-18-03.pdt Withdrawn and Rescheduled to the Concurrent Meeting of the Oakland Redevelopment Agency / City Council 2) Adopt an Agency Resolution authorizing amendment to the repayment agreement with the City of Oakland and increasing City appropriations by $800,000 for predevelopment work on the Fox Theater and wrap around buildings, and authorizing the Agency Administrator to enter into an exclusive negotiating agreement with the Paramount Theatre for the Arts, Inc., or Fox Theatre I Corporation to redevelop the Fox Theater and wrap around buildings Attachments: Item 22 11-18-03.pd Withdrawn and Rescheduled to the Concurrent Meeting of the Oakland Redevelopment Agency / City Council Subject: Measure X Limited Charter Review Committee Recommendations From: Measure X Limited Charter Review Committee Recommendation: A Continued discussion to Approve a Report regarding a 23 Resolution for the Council's consideration reflecting Charter amendments prepared by San Francisco City Attorney's Office that reflect the Measure X Limited Charter Review Committee and City Councilmember recommendations regarding (A) Balance of Powers among Branches of Government, (B) the Elected City Attorney, (C) Setting Pay for Elected Officials, (D) Term Limits for Elected Officials, (E) Mayor's Attendance at Council Meetings, (F) Number of Councilmembers and At-Large Representatives, (G) City Council Structure and Procedures; and (H) Role of the City Manager (I) determining whether said Charter amendment shall appear on the March 2, 2004 or November 2, 2004 Ballot (J) need to check report (TITLE CHANGE) 6 11-4-03.pdf, Attachments: 16 Attach A 11-04-03.pd 16 Attach B 11-04-03.pdf, 23 11-18-03.pdf The following individuals spoke in favor of this item: - Judy Cox - Judy Belcher The following individual spoke against this time: Anne Wellington The following individual spoke on this item and indicated a neutral postion: - Naomi Schiff The following individuals spoke on this item and did not indicate a position: - Sanjiv Handa - Judy Bank The November 18, 2003 City Council directed staff to prepare the appropriate legislation to reflect the following: 1) Any portion of recommended increase in compensation that would result in an overall raise in excess of 5% requires voter approval; 2) Retain the salary formula for the Mayor and add salary formula to the City Attorney and City Auditor 3) Mayor shall advise the Council before removing City Administrator; 4) Increase public meetings by the Mayor to four (4); 5) Reduce the time for Council action to fill an appointment left vacant by the Mayor from 180 days to 90 days; and 6) Place this Measure on the March 2, 2004 ballot. | 16 | OaklandCityCouncil/2003-11-18.pdf |
